How does Dynatrace correlate user actions into user sessions?

Explanation:
Dynatrace correlates user actions into user sessions primarily through the use of cookies and local storage. This approach allows Dynatrace to uniquely identify and track individual user sessions across a web application or service. When a user interacts with an application, Dynatrace can create a session ID that is stored in a cookie or local storage mechanism on the user's device. This ID persists between different interactions, enabling the platform to stitch together a sequence of user actions into a cohesive session. Additionally, the reliance on cookies and local storage helps maintain session consistency even when the user navigates between different pages or makes multiple requests within the application. This method is essential for accurately capturing the full user experience, as it facilitates the consolidation of their actions into a single logical session, thereby providing insights into user behavior, performance issues, and overall application usage analytics.
